摘要
Films of polythiophene were prepared by electrochemical oxidation under ultrasonic field. The ultrasonic irradiation had an influence on the conditions and the properties of the as-polymerized films. In the absence of ultrasonic irradiation, the as-polymerized films became brittle gradually when the electrolytic current density exceeded the value of 5 mA/cm**2. Flexible and tough films with the tensile modulus of 3. 2 GPa and strength of 90 MPa were obtained even at a high current density of 10 mA/cm**2 with ultrasonic irradiation. The doping level increased with increasing electrolytic current density at a given current density, the levels for the irradiated series were highrthan those for unirradiated series, which led to a high electrical conductivity (130-150 S/cm) for the irradiated series. Cyclic voltammetry indicated a higher diffusion rate for the films prepared under ultrasonic field compared with those prepared without irradiation.
